The employment rates in Georgia reflect an encouraging trend for job seekers. According to the Georgia Department of Labor, Georgia added 23,100 jobs over the year ending in March 2025.

Remote roles have become one of the fastest-growing job categories, and Sci-Tech Today reports approximately 16.3% of Georgia’s workforce works from home or remotely.

These are a few entry-level, remote jobs hiring now in Georgia with no medical degree or tech background required.
